A Deep Dive Into “prefixing”
Meaning
- [Verb]
- present participle and gerund of prefix
- [Adjective]
- (linguistics) Of a language, characterised by heavy use of prefixes to create grammatical forms; as opposed to suffixing.
- [Noun]
- The act by which something is prefixed.
